Upcoming workshop: Transracial Adoption

AMARA Community Workshop

Description

Angela Tucker, trans-racial adoptee and Amara’s Director of Post-Adoption Services, expands on Amara’s Partnering for Permanency class with this interactive and informational workshop.

The workshop includes facilitated discussions with parents and caregivers about privilege, implicit bias, micro-aggression and an adult adoptee panel. Teaching modalities will include a mix of lecture, video, open dialogue and structured activities. Participants will engage in activities designed to assist in becoming more comfortable talking to others about race and culture, particularly within the framework of trans-racial adoption.
